TORONTO (Canada): The
unfortunate circumstances that the people of Kashmir are confronted with
must be addressed, states Grenadian Prime Minister.
Keith Mitchell, Prime Minister of Grenada, in a letter thanked Mushtaq A.
Jeelani, Executive Director of the Kashmiri-Canadian Council (KCC) for his
letter concerning the unresolved issue of Kashmir and intensification of
systematic human rights violations against civilians in Indian-administered
Jammu and Kashmir, sais a communique received by 'Pakistan Times' [Daily Web
Newspaper] from Toronto on Wednesday.
The Prime Minister expressed his appreciation for being informed about the
Kashmir issue: “I appreciate your pointed explanation of the unfortunate
circumstances that the people of Kashmir are confronted with, and the
subsequent role that the Commonwealth can play in seeking to address the
unresolved issue.”
The Prime Minister underlines: “As the Commonwealth continues to promote
human rights, democracy, good governance and the rule of law,” he concludes
with an assurance, “I can assure you that plight of the Kashmiris will be an
item of serious discussion [on the Commonwealth’s agenda].”● |
